The latest music phone to be released from Verizon Wireless is the Samsung SCH-A930. Contrary to other phone manufacturers Samsung is going a bit against the grain with this far from slim design. I find it to be one of the most refreshing phone models to be released this quarter. It has a strong industry feel, with a sharp black finish lit up with a simplistic monochrome LCD. And ofcourse since it is a new Verizon product it comes with VCAST, customers can browse, preview, download, and play high-quality digital music and video right onto the A930. The playback keys are right on the external face of the phone, so it makes for a very easy to use portable media player as well.
- EV-DO highspeed data
- Bluetooth
- 1.3 megapixel camera
- microSD card slot
- Speakerphone
- Rotating Camera Lens
